❄️ I can't take how sweet this romance was. Like hot-chocolate-with-marshmallows sweet. It was slow and gentle and cozy. A perfectly Christmas-y, small town romance.
🎄 The relationship between the leads felt believable and warm. The writing was atmospheric and made me really wish Lovelight Farms was real. I loved the supporting characters and I'm glad they all get their own books. I was just giddy throughout the whole thing.
⛸️ This felt like Emily Henry meets Hallmark Channel movie. Lower stakes than Henry's stuff and generally less emotional. But still playful, still focusing on relationships first, and still hard to put down.
🧣 Honestly, the reason I would take half a star is because I wish there was more friendship detailed before the fake dating scheme at the beginning and because I still felt like there were a few threads dangling at the end (maybe they'll be tied up in the other books?). But in total, this tips more toward perfect than not, and I feel like it was what it needed to be for what it was, if that makes sense.
☃️ A+ holiday read. Best enjoyed with hot chocolate and Christmas cookies

The writing is quite nice, and the story was reasonably enjoyable. However I was looking for a light, feel-good holiday romance, and was surprised at the serious tone of the book. There were light moments, but a lot of time was spent on Estelle and Luka's grief about their respective parents' deaths (her mother, his father). I feel like this bogged down the story. It's not that it was bad, but it's not what I was looking for. I enjoyed the mystery aspect of the sabotage on the farm, and the influencer's visit was enjoyable as well. I also enjoyed the side characters, especially Beckett and Layla. I liked the conclusion of the story, especially regarding the farm's financial woes. If you're looking for a Christmas story with some serious themes, this would work for you. The spicy scenes were alright as well, I'd say this is a medium-high heat book.
